Why Maintenance Information Matters

When you buy new windows, you are making a long-term investment in your home or business. The quality of the product is important, but so too is the way you look after it. Proper maintenance protects the moving parts, prevents draughts, improves insulation, and extends the life of the frames, seals, and glazing.

A professional supplier will always provide guidance on how often to clean and inspect your windows, what cleaning products are safe to use, and what early signs of wear you should look out for. Knowing this information in advance gives you control and confidence. It means you can plan simple maintenance routines and avoid unnecessary repair bills later on.

What Suppliers Should Disclose Before Installation

A professional and transparent window supplier will always make maintenance expectations clear before starting work. Customers should receive written or verbal guidance that covers several key areas.

First, suppliers should explain the maintenance schedule, outlining what needs to be checked after installation, what to inspect quarterly, and what to plan annually. Regular checks can include cleaning the glass, lubricating hinges, and ensuring vents and seals remain free from dust and debris.

Second, they should provide a list of approved cleaning products that are safe for your specific materials. Harsh chemicals or abrasive tools can cause long-term damage to modern coatings, frames, and seals, and may even void your warranty.

Third, the supplier should identify inspection points. Homeowners should know which areas are most vulnerable to wear, such as gaskets, trickle vents, and frame joints.

Finally, a responsible supplier will clearly explain warranty conditions, outlining what customer actions or neglect could invalidate the guarantee.

Cleaning Your Glass

Caring for your windows does not have to be complicated. A simple routine performed a few times a year can prevent most common issues.

Begin by cleaning your glass regularly with a soft cloth and a gentle detergent. This removes dirt, salt, and environmental residue that can cause discolouration or reduce light transmission. In coastal areas such as Dorset, cleaning may be required slightly more often due to salt in the air.

Check all Seals, Vents and Drainage Channels

Next, check all seals, vents, and drainage channels. These small details make a big difference to how well your windows perform. If you notice condensation, it might be time to clean or clear your trickle vents to restore proper airflow.

Hinges, locks, and handles should be lubricated with a silicone-based spray to keep them smooth and rust-free. A few minutes of care twice a year can prevent stiff or jammed mechanisms.

Inspect the Frames

After heavy rain or storms, it is wise to inspect the frames for any signs of water ingress or loose fittings. Addressing these small issues promptly can prevent more serious damage.

Finally, keep a simple record of your maintenance activities. If you ever need to make a warranty claim, being able to demonstrate proper care makes the process quicker and easier.

By following this guidance, your windows will remain energy-efficient, secure, and visually appealing for many years.
